Defined in 1 files as a function:
Referenced in 31 files:
- contrib/llvm/lib/Analysis/DemandedBits.cpp, line 82
- contrib/llvm/lib/Analysis/InstructionSimplify.cpp
- contrib/llvm/lib/Analysis/Lint.cpp, line 640
- contrib/llvm/lib/Analysis/ScalarEvolution.cpp, line 5884
- contrib/llvm/lib/Analysis/ScalarEvolutionExpander.cpp, line 891
- contrib/llvm/lib/CodeGen/Analysis.cpp
- contrib/llvm/lib/Target/Hexagon/HexagonLoopIdiomRecognition.cpp, line 2274
- contrib/llvm/lib/Target/Hexagon/HexagonVectorLoopCarriedReuse.cpp, line 399
- contrib/llvm/lib/Transforms/IPO/GlobalOpt.cpp
- contrib/llvm/lib/Transforms/InstCombine/InstCombineCalls.cpp, line 3579
- contrib/llvm/lib/Transforms/InstCombine/InstructionCombining.cpp, line 2894
- contrib/llvm/lib/Transforms/Scalar/ADCE.cpp, line 326
- contrib/llvm/lib/Transforms/Scalar/BDCE.cpp, line 94
- contrib/llvm/lib/Transforms/Scalar/GVN.cpp, line 2184
- contrib/llvm/lib/Transforms/Scalar/GVNHoist.cpp, line 1117
- contrib/llvm/lib/Transforms/Scalar/IndVarSimplify.cpp
- contrib/llvm/lib/Transforms/Scalar/JumpThreading.cpp
- contrib/llvm/lib/Transforms/Scalar/LoopDeletion.cpp, line 86
- contrib/llvm/lib/Transforms/Scalar/LoopInterchange.cpp
- contrib/llvm/lib/Transforms/Scalar/LoopRotation.cpp, line 365
- contrib/llvm/lib/Transforms/Scalar/LoopUnrollPass.cpp, line 520
- contrib/llvm/lib/Transforms/Scalar/LoopUnswitch.cpp
- contrib/llvm/lib/Transforms/Scalar/SROA.cpp, line 1222
- contrib/llvm/lib/Transforms/Scalar/SimpleLoopUnswitch.cpp, line 678
- contrib/llvm/lib/Transforms/Scalar/TailRecursionElimination.cpp
- contrib/llvm/lib/Transforms/Utils/CloneFunction.cpp, line 348
- contrib/llvm/lib/Transforms/Utils/CodeExtractor.cpp, line 268
- contrib/llvm/lib/Transforms/Utils/FlattenCFG.cpp
- contrib/llvm/lib/Transforms/Utils/Local.cpp
- contrib/llvm/lib/Transforms/Utils/SimplifyCFG.cpp
- contrib/llvm/lib/Transforms/Vectorize/LoopVectorize.cpp, line 4583